Pure Calorie-Free Sweet Ingredient
Stevia, a natural sweetener, offers a no-calorie alternative to regular sugars, rendering it desirable for those looking to cut their caloric intake. Extracted from the leaves of the Stevia rebaudiana plant, it contains compounds called steviol glycosides, which provide sweetness without contributing calories. This characteristic makes liquid stevia an ideal option for individuals following low-calorie or ketogenic diets. Additionally, it permits for the enjoyment of sweet flavors in beverages and recipes without the negative effects of sugar intake. The versatility of liquid stevia allows it to be used in various kitchen uses, from beverages to desserts, providing a sugar-like taste while encouraging a healthier lifestyle.

Understanding How Liquid Stevia Complements a Keto Diet
While many individuals on a keto diet look for sugar alternatives, stevia liquid stands out as a popular choice due to its zero-calorie, low-carbohydrate makeup. This natural sweetener, derived from the leaves of the Stevia rebaudiana plant, complements ketogenic principles, which emphasize reduced carb consumption to encourage ketosis. Unlike traditional sweeteners, stevia liquid does not elevate glucose levels, making it appropriate for those controlling their blood sugar.
Furthermore, its concentrated sweetness allows for only reduced quantities to be used, ensuring that users can enjoy sweet sensations without sacrificing their fitness objectives. Liquid stevia can be seamlessly incorporated into numerous keto-friendly recipes, featuring beverages, desserts, and sauces, maximizing taste without incorporating carbs. This utility, combined with its health benefits, solidifies liquid stevia's role as a significant tool for those adhering to a ketogenic way of living.

Contents To Review
Selecting the right liquid stevia involves thorough evaluation of its components. Consumers should prioritize products containing authentic stevia extract, specifically those derived from the Stevia rebaudiana plant, as this ensures authenticity and purity. It is also essential to check for additional ingredients, such as organic flavors or additives, which can impact the overall nutritional advantages. Some liquid stevias may include glycerin or alcohol as delivery systems; opting for those without synthetic ingredients is advisable. In addition, examining the sweetening potency is important, as some brands may use diluting agents that weaken the sweetening power. By concentrating on these elements, people can choose a liquid stevia that aligns with their nutritional choices and wellness objectives, particularly in a keto-friendly setting.

What Is the Shelf Life of Liquid Stevia?
Liquid stevia ordinarily has a storage duration of about two to three years when stored correctly, away from bright rays and heat. It preserves consistency due to its strong potency and lack of calories.
Is Liquid Stevia Suitable for Use in Baking Dishes?
Liquid stevia can be used in baking recipes, although modifications might be required due to its potent sweetness. It works effectively in many desserts, but getting the desired texture may require additional components for balance.
